Well, I don't know if any of this has already been mentioned, but:
Hostile Aquatic Creatures/Mobs:
I think having aquatic creatures would make things pretty interesting. Sharks or something in deep water, which can give you shark meat and shark hide, which could be used for something crazy, like making a suite that allows underwater travel or something fun.
Make Boats Less Glitchy and Customizable:
Boats are terrible, the things fall apart by running into lillypads for christ sake. They just need to be made smoother, and it would be cool if we could make bigger boats that say, could be lived on or something neat like that, that way you can sail the Minecraft world and take your house with you.
Add Quest:
I think villagers, maybe a wandering NPC, or old tomes/notes you find could lead you onto a quest to defeat a certain new boss or explore an old temple/fortress structure that they lead you to, or at least give you the general direction of in some way, such as a map. With that being said...
New Bosses and Fortresses:
I think there should be new boss mobs or something added to the game. You know, big fights that require a little more than just swinging at the target for a few seconds. These bosses could be located in some larger, diverse auto-generated temples or fortresses, such as an underwater femple, or something of that nature.
Mountain Biome:
This may be a little too similar to the extreme hills biome, but I thought having a mountain biome would be cool. This mountain could feature new mobs, such as mountain trolls, and rather than being made of stone or dirt, it could be made of a tanner, rock material, which I've yet to think of a use for beyond looks. And when I say Mountain, I mean an effing mountain. Far larger than extreme hills.
New Mob Types:
I've actually thought of quite a few new mob types I thought would be cool. Heres the list.
Goblins & Imps - Goblins are a type of passive-aggressive mob that does not actively seek to attack the player, but will become hostile if you get too close to them. They are capable of building their own houses, and actively seek to take livestock (such as chickens, cows, pigs, etc), thus making them an annoyance to the player by killing them or herding them to their auto-generated camps. They will also set up camps near areas where lots of livestock are naturally occuring, and might eventually show up if they are being farmed for a long time by a player. They will attempt to break into your farming area and kill or herd them away. Goblins are capable of breeding, and their children are Imps.
Trolls - Trolls are large creatures that dwell in extreme hills biomes (or my previously mentioned mountain biome), or rarely in very large caves. They are passive-aggressive, and will only attack the player if they get too close. Trolls are very slow, but they have a wide area of attack with their clubs.
Bandits - Bandits are NPC that will rarely, but sometimes try to enter your home when your sleeping, and attempt to take things from chest if they are located in your home. You have a 65 percent chance to wake up automatically, unless using a door bell (item mentioned below). if the bandit manages to grab something, they will try to flee, but they might attack you instead. Killing them drops what they stole plus other loot. Bandits are less likely to enter homes that are underground, or heavily fortified. Bandits will also attack NPC villages at night. During the day, they tend to only be at their auto-generated bandit fortresses. Following one that is fleeing from you might lead you to one.
Vulture - Vultures are a flying mob that is normally out during the day. It will swoop down and peck at players, especially if they are carrying meat on them.
Sharks - Sharks are an aquatic mob that wonder around in ocean biomes. Players caught swimming in deep water might come across one and be attacked, especially if they are carrying raw meat on them. Sharks won't actively seek to attack boats, but they might if the boat gets too close to them. A player can fish for sharks in a boat using a harpoon.
New Weapons/Items:
Spear: This melee weapon can attack targets farther away than the sword, and can also be thrown. They do slightly less damage than the sword, and fly a shorter distance when thrown compared to the bow and arrow.
Battle Axe: This melee weapon does more damage than the sword, but swings slower and requires more resources to make.
Door Bell: This item will make a small chime when the door it's attached to opens. This will automatically wake you if a Bandit tries to enter your home.
Aquatic Shark Suit: Created from shark hide, this suit set (hat, torso, boots, and leggings) allows you to swim underwater faster, and not attract the attention of sharks while doing so in Ocean Biomes. The hat allows you to breath underwater for longer periods of time. You will also no longer mine blocks slower while underwater.
Incompatibility Device: Just for the hell of it, some device that does all kinds of crazy when used. I think something like this would be fun if you were bored, and i could be used in conjunction with entering a new location, obtaining new items, encountering new bosses, etc.
